Project

General

Profile

Actions

Emulator Issues #6964

closed

Vsync is always enabled with open gl and can't be disabled.

Added by kostamarino about 10 years ago.

Status:
Fixed
Priority:
High
Assignee:
Category:
GFX
% Done:

0%

Operating system:
N/A
Issue type:
Bug
Milestone:
Current
Regression:
No
Relates to usability:
No
Relates to performance:
No
Easy:
No
Relates to maintainability:
No
Regression start:
Fixed in:

Description

Using 4.0-653 from https://el.dolphin-emu.org/download/
in a system with windows 7 x64 and nvidia 560ti gpu, i can't seem to be able to disable vsync when using opengl no matter what (in dolphin options, pressing tab or either with nvidia drivers).
4.0-611 seems to work fine.


Related issues 1 (0 open1 closed)

Has duplicate Emulator - Emulator Issues #6966: Unable to fully remove frame limit with OpenGL + V-SyncDuplicate

Actions
Actions #1

Updated by kostamarino about 10 years ago

After a bit of testing merge branch 'GLExtensions' seems to be the culprit (revision 5a599d472e49 or 4.0-651).

Actions #2

Updated by MayImilae about 10 years ago

  • Category set to gfx
Actions #3

Updated by Sonicadvance1 about 10 years ago

  • Status changed from New to Accepted

I know what the issue is, I'll fix it in a bit.

Actions #4

Updated by Sonicadvance1 about 10 years ago

  • Status changed from Accepted to Fixed

This issue was closed by revision bea484e12f98.

Actions #5

Updated by kostamarino about 10 years ago

Hmm, this is weird, it seems that before GLExtensions branch merge vsync was always disabled in the first place and after it it is always enabled (the opposite default behavior), nevertheless i can't alter the option using dolphin.

Actions #6

Updated by kostamarino about 10 years ago

Ok with builds before gl extensions merge you could alter the vsync setting in the gui and it worked but if you pressed tab just once it would be disabled and stay disabled for every game and always until you restarted dolphin (this gave me the impression that it is always disabled). I found this out having framelimit disabled in order to see immediately if frames are limited by vsync. With builds after the merge until the latest the setting is always enabled no matter if you restart dolphin, use the gui, and press or not press tab at all.

Actions #7

Updated by rachelbryk about 10 years ago

Fixed that .

Actions #8

Updated by kostamarino about 10 years ago

  • Status changed from Fixed to Accepted

Using d3d i managed to see that the tab issue is fixed, but the initial issue is not with opengl so i am reopening this.

Actions #9

Updated by kostamarino about 10 years ago

Issue 6966 has been merged into this issue.

Actions #10

Updated by captgrrr about 10 years ago

I'm actually getting the opposite. Vsync is always disabled in OpenGL. Looks like the ini is getting set ok. Double checked my video card driver settings as well. d3d is working fine.

win8.1 x64
intel 3770k@4.5ghz
radeon 7950
16gb ram

Actions #11

Updated by pauldacheez about 10 years ago

  • Status changed from Accepted to Fixed

This issue should be fixed by revision r650bae12e1dd. If not, complain more.

Actions #12

Updated by JMC4789 about 10 years ago

  • Status changed from Fixed to Accepted

Still not fixed

Actions #13

Updated by pauldacheez about 10 years ago

Aww.

Actions #14

Updated by kodiacktech about 10 years ago

I'm getting the opposite as well. Vsync is always disabled and setting the option in Dolphin does nothing. To prevent screen tearing in fullscreen mode I must force vertical sync in Catalyst Control Center; however, forcing vsync via CCC unfortunately prevents me from going above 60 FPS, which limits the VPS to usually anywhere from 60-120.

Actions #16

Updated by MayImilae about 10 years ago

  • Priority set to High
  • Milestone set to Current
Actions #17

Updated by Sonicadvance1 about 10 years ago

  • Status changed from Accepted to Fixed

Fixed by b1e94cbbb5e3ffad94aaf08caf72574dbe74cc62

Actions #18

Updated by kostamarino about 10 years ago

Tried it, and vsync doesn't seem to be disabled by pressing tab though.

Actions #19

Updated by Sonicadvance1 about 10 years ago

That's a different issue.

Actions #20

Updated by JMC4789 almost 10 years ago

I'm fairly certain this is finally fixed for real.

I'm going to credit 4.0-1981 > https://dolphin-emu.org/download/dev/aae16309490c1559bde43ac4c51525b8d827c7cc/ for fixing it the rest of the way.

Actions

Also available in: Atom PDF